The Pantry is a free food support service for current UOW students experiencing financial hardship. Items are displayed on shelves and assigned point values instead of dollar amounts. The Pantry’s core goals are to reduce food insecurity and ease financial stress for UOW students. By providing access to nutritious, high‑quality items, we help students avoid relying on cheaper, less healthy alternatives and support their overall well‑being.
Pulse is proud to acknowledge the dedication of our student volunteers, whose hard work keeps this service running.
Pulse Pantry is funded by Pulse and the Student Services and Amenities Fee (SSAF). Stock is purchased from UOW’s Village Grocer or donated by generous partners including Aspire Catering & Events, Gillette, Kotex, OzHarvest, and Share the Dignity.
Sustainability is another key focus. Around 90% of our products are suitable for a vegan diet, and we do not offer meat products to help reduce emissions, particularly those associated with cold storage.
